Logo of Huzzle

Front End Developer - React

image

Siemens

16d ago

  • Job
    Full-time
    Junior, Mid & Senior Level
  • Software Engineering
    IT & Cybersecurity
  • Pune

AI generated summary

  • You should have 5-7 years of experience, with 1-3 years in React, strong skills in JavaScript, HTML5, and agile methodologies, plus exposure to cloud, microservices, and containerization.
  • You will design, implement, and own front-end applications, ensuring performance and quality. Collaborate in Agile teams, coordinate with back-end developers, and participate in code and design reviews.

Requirements

  • You need to actively participate in requirements (business, functional, technical) understanding, solution designing and implementation with quality outcome
  • You need to work in agile, self-organizing teams, in which you will take end-to-end responsibilities for your assignments
  • Taking complete ownership of multiple application front end interfaces
  • Delivering a complete front-end application
  • Ensuring high performance on desktop/web
  • Writing tested, idiomatic, and documented JavaScript, HTML, React and CSS
  • Coordinating with the back-end developer in the process of building the REST Plus API
  • Understand existing high- and low-level design and actively participate in design reviews
  • Participate in code reviews, do Static Code Analysis and Dynamic Code Analysis
  • Configuration Management: Check in, check out, Branching, Labeling, Merging (preferably Jenkins, Gitlab CI/CD and docker)
  • We are looking for B.E. or B.Tech. with 5-7 years of total experience and relevant experience of 1-3 years in Ember JS/AngularJS/ ReactJS
  • Proficiency with Ember Js, AngularJS, ReactJS, JavaScript and HTML5
  • Ability to work across new age front end scripting languages and adapt to rapidly changing technology stack
  • Exposure to cloud application deployment, microservices, auth0, containerization, docker etc. will be a plus
  • Strong verbal and written communication skills in English
  • Candidate with Dashboard development experience is a plus.

Responsibilities

  • You need to actively participate in requirements (business, functional, technical) understanding, solution designing and implementation with quality outcome
  • You need to work in agile, self-organizing teams, in which you will take end-to-end responsibilities for your assignments
  • Taking complete ownership of multiple application front end interfaces
  • Delivering a complete front-end application
  • Ensuring high performance on desktop/web
  • Writing tested, idiomatic, and documented JavaScript, HTML, React and CSS
  • Coordinating with the back-end developer in the process of building the REST Plus API
  • Understand existing high- and low-level design and actively participate in design reviews
  • Participate in code reviews, do Static Code Analysis and Dynamic Code Analysis
  • Configuration Management: Check in, check out, Branching, Labeling, Merging (preferably Jenkins, Gitlab CI/CD and docker)

FAQs

What is the job title for the position being offered?

The job title is Front End Developer - React.

What is the main technology stack required for this role?

The main technology stack includes ReactJS, JavaScript, HTML5, and CSS.

What are the key responsibilities of a Front End Developer in this position?

Key responsibilities include participating in requirements understanding, solution design, implementation of front-end applications, ensuring high performance, and coordinating with back-end developers for API development.

What qualifications are required for this position?

A B.E. or B.Tech degree with 5-7 years of total experience and 1-3 years of relevant experience in frameworks like Ember JS, AngularJS, or ReactJS is required.

Is experience in cloud application deployment beneficial for this role?

Yes, exposure to cloud application deployment, microservices, Auth0, and containerization using Docker is considered a plus.

Will the candidate need to participate in code reviews?

Yes, the candidate will be required to participate in code reviews, static code analysis, and dynamic code analysis.

What additional experience is seen as advantageous for this role?

Experience in dashboard development is seen as an additional advantage.

Where is this job-based primarily located?

This role is primarily based in Pune, India.

How does Siemens support its employees in this position?

Siemens offers hybrid working opportunities, a diverse and inclusive culture, a variety of learning and development opportunities, and an attractive compensation package.

Will the employee need to travel for this job?

Yes, the employee may be required to visit other locations within India and internationally.

What kind of teams will the candidate work with?

The candidate will work with agile, self-organizing teams taking end-to-end responsibilities for assignments.

Are communication skills important for this position?

Yes, strong verbal and written communication skills in English are important for this position.

How does Siemens view diversity in its hiring process?

Siemens is dedicated to equality and welcomes applications that reflect the diversity of the communities they serve. All employment decisions are based on qualifications, merit, and business needs.

Technology to transform the everyday.

Technology
Industry
10,001+
Employees
1847
Founded Year

Mission & Purpose

Siemens is a technology company focused on industry, infrastructure, transport, and healthcare. From more resource-efficient factories, resilient supply chains, and smarter buildings and grids, to cleaner and more comfortable transportation as well as advanced healthcare, the company creates technology with purpose adding real value for customers. By combining the real and the digital worlds, Siemens empowers its customers to transform their industries and markets, helping them to transform the everyday for billions of people. Siemens also owns a majority stake in the publicly listed company Siemens Healthineers, a globally leading medical technology provider shaping the future of healthcare. In addition, Siemens holds a minority stake in Siemens Energy, a global leader in the transmission and generation of electrical power. In fiscal 2022, which ended on September 30, 2022, the Siemens Group generated revenue of €72.0 billion and net income of €4.4 billion. As of September 30, 2022, the company had around 311,000 employees worldwide.